    Climate sensitivity of Abies alba Mill. in marginal Mediterranean low-elevation stands reveals new insights into the ecological potential of the species

    No full text
    Understanding the ecological needs of forest tree species at the warm edge of their range can provide valuable information for management strategies in a warming climate. Here, we carried out a dendroecological study focusing on submediterranean and mesomediterranean low elevation (i.e., 30-800 m asl) marginal stands of Abies alba Mill. (silver fir) under warm mean July-August temperatures of 23-25 degrees C. Such marginal stands are compared to an Apennine core stand at 1450 m asl in central Italy amid the climatic niche with optimal growing conditions. Additionally, we used understory vegetation surveys to assess local growing conditions. During periods of low growth rates, the growth of low-elevation stands is significantly influenced by both short-term current-year climatic signals (monthly to seasonal; immediate effect on growth) and long-term (pluriannual) cumulative signals, whereas the strength of the climatic influence progressively increases from the monthly to the multi-annual scale. Trees are adversely affected by high summer and early autumn temperatures and drought and benefit from sufficient rainfall in late summer, autumn, and early winter, in addition to spring rainfall. Moreover, when temperature and moisture are high, low-elevation stands likely benefit from a prolonged late growing season. These findings illustrate that the growth of A. alba at low elevations is rather limited by moisture availability than high temperatures. In contrast, silver fir in the cooler and moister uppermost reference stand was less affected by current year drought and cumulative climatic effects. Our results confirm the potential of A. alba to thrive under warm climates, as previously evidenced by palaeoecological data and dynamic modelling. However, in Mediterranean ecosystems, this capacity is modulated by local growing conditions, highlighting the need for site-oriented management strategies

    Caratterizzazione geotecnica e monitoraggio degli argini fluviali per l’analisi della suscettibilità al sifonamento

    No full text
    La presenza dei fontanazzi lungo gli argini fluviali, ossia di zone di fuoriuscita di sabbia fluidificata che si accumula sul piano campagna, rappresenta il tipico indizio dell’innesco e della progressione di un processo noto come “erosione retrogressiva per sottofiltrazione”. Il fenomeno, caratterizzato dalla formazione di piccoli canali che dal piede dell’argine si sviluppano a ritroso verso il fiume, può condurre alla rottura arginale. Specifiche condizioni stratigrafiche predispongono all’insorgenza di questo processo, generalmente legato agli eventi di piena. In Italia, lungo il fiume Po, sono stati rilevati oltre 130 fontanazzi. Fra i tratti arginali più documentati vi è quello di Boretto, con fontanazzi “storici” e “relitti”. La presente memoria descrive le numerose informazioni raccolte per questo sito mediante indagini geotecniche e attività di monitoraggio, e discute l’affidabilità di noti metodi di analisi per valutare la suscettibilità arginale al sifonamento

    Cognitive translation and interpreting studies – an evolving research area and a thriving community of practice

    No full text
    In this introduction we look at the evolving research area of Cognitive Translation and Interpreting Studies (CTIS) through the lens of articles which report on cutting edge research in a variety of multilectal mediated communicative events. Seven contributions in this issue expand the frame of Cognitive Translation and Interpreting Studies with detailed, empirically grounded accounts of how language and mind interact in mediated communication. The new empirical evidence challenges key concepts, such as cognitive effort or translation expertise, and sheds light on overlooked areas of translation reception and accessibility research. Although the studies vary in topic and methods, they converge on a more sophisticated view of cognition in multilectal mediated communication which underscores its complexity and dynamics. The findings point to two overarching trends in CTIS research: (1) conceptual progress and (2) methodological sophistication. The contributors to this special issue are all mid- and early-career researchers and the development of their research expertise mirrors that of CTIS as a community of practice committed to producing knowledge based on empirical evidence and enriched by meaningful collaborative exchanges with neighboring disciplines

    Fatal Hemorrhagic Septicemia in Common Guitarfish (Rhinobatos rhinobatos) Caused by Photobacterium damselae Subsp. damselae in a Controlled Environment

    No full text
    Elasmobranchs, including sharks and rays, are commonly housed in public aquariums due to their ecological significance and educational value. The common guitarfish (Rhinobatos rhinobatos), currently listed as ‘Critically Endangered’ by the IUCN, is particularly susceptible to population declines due to overfishing and bycatch. While generally considered robust, individuals in captivity may experience stress-related health issues, increasing their susceptibility to infectious diseases. This study investigates a mortality event affecting three 20-year-old guitarfish kept in a public aquarium. The fish exhibited respiratory distress and ataxia before sudden death. Necropsy findings included external hemorrhages and severe hemorrhagic enteritis. Bacteriological analyses identified Photobacterium damselae subsp. damselae in all specimens through MALDI-TOF and PCR sequencing, while parasitological tests and RT-PCR for Betanodavirus were negative. Histopathology revealed bacterial aggregates in the gills, heart and kidney, consistent with systemic bacterial septicemia. P. damselae subsp. damselae is an opportunistic marine pathogen known to cause hemorrhagic septicemia in various fish species. This case represents the first documented occurrence of fatal P. damselae subsp. damselae septicemia in captive guitarfish. Understanding the impact of infectious diseases in confined environments is essential for improving the health management of endangered elasmobranchs in aquariums and conservation programs

    Understanding workability of low carbon cements through advanced water detection techniques

    No full text
    : Limestone Calcined Clay Cement (LC3) is a sustainable alternative to Ordinary Portland Cement (OPC), capable of significantly reducing CO2 emissions. However, the mechanisms by which calcined clay affects fresh-state workability are not yet fully understood. In this study, different cements were formulated with variable content of calcined clay to investigate its effect on workability and early hydration. Advanced techniques, including 1H Time-Domain Nuclear Magnetic Resonance (TD-NMR) and Differential Scanning Calorimetry (DSC), were applied to detect free water in fresh pastes and compared with rheological measurements. Results indicate that increasing the calcined clay content leads to rapid consumption of free water which in turn substantially raises superplasticizer demand, as shown by mortar flow-table tests, and alters paste rheology, as measured by rheometer. Analyses of the first hours of hydration reveal that the available free water can drop dramatically in the presence of calcined clay, providing a clear explanation for the observed increases in yield stress and viscosity. Despite these early rheological challenges, LC3 formulations achieved excellent mechanical performance at 28 days, in some cases surpassing that of OPC CEM I. These findings highlight the dual role of calcined clay in modifying fresh-state behavior and ensuring long-term strength

    Cross-correlated experimental and theoretical characterisation of orpiment As2S3, a potential material for new advanced technological applications

    No full text
    In the ever-growing search for new materials in optical, electronic and photovoltaic applications, chalcogenides, such as amorphous diarsenic trisulfide (As2S3), are being deeply investigated. However, very few and incomplete data are available on crystalline As2S3 (space group P21/n), known as mineral orpiment. In the present work, several experimental techniques were employed to analyse the crystal structure, morphology, chemical composition and vibrational properties of the bulk and mechanically cleaved (010) orpiment surface. Also, cross-correlated atomic-scale ab initio simulations corroborated and explained the new experimental data. Orpiment showed a semiconducting behaviour, with an indirect band gap of 2.44 eV and an optical Γ-Γ gap of 2.63 eV, which agrees with previous optical-absorption edge measurements. Furthermore, the complete stiffness tensor and the phonon band structure were reported for the first time. All these quantities are of utmost importance for devising new possible applications of crystalline orpiment in the technological and materials science fields

    La noción de publicidad relevante a los efectos de la integración contractual prevista en el artículo 61 del texto refundido de consumidores y en otras normas sectoriales afines

    No full text
    According to Article 61 of Consolidated Text of the General Law on Consumers and Users (TRLGDCU), the content of advertising is integral to the contract, in the sense that the consumer is entitled to demand that the trader complies with the advertising content even if it does not form part of the contractual document. This paper analyses the concept of advertising which is relevant for the purposes of this provision, since not all advertising contents are suitable for the consumer-contractor to be able to successfully exercise the power of contractual integration conferred by the aforementioned article 61. Naturally, the conclusions reached on this issue are also valid for other sectoral rules on the advertising integration of the contract. Specifically, we refer to those governing the areas of purchase and sale and rental of housing, as well as package travel, which, like the referred Article 61 TRLGDCU, also confer contractual relevance to advertising.Según el artículo 61 del Texto Refundido de Consumidores (TRLGDCU), el contenido de la publicidad integra el contrato, en el sentido de que el consumidor está facultado para exigir al empresario que cumpla los contenidos publicitarios aun cuando estos no formen parte del documento contractual. En este trabajo se analiza el concepto de publicidad relevante a los efectos de dicho precepto, pues no todos los contenidos publicitarios son aptos para que el contratante-consumidor pueda ejercitar con éxito la facultad de integración contractual que le confiere el antecitado artículo 61. Como es natural, las conclusiones obtenidas sobre esta cuestión son válidas también para otras normas sectoriales en materia de integración publicitaria del contrato. Nos referimos, en concreto, a las que rigen en los ámbitos de la compraventa y el arrendamiento de vivienda, así como de los viajes combinados, que, al igual que el referido artículo 61 TRLGDCU, también confieren relevancia contractual a la publicidad

    Tra realismo e modernismo: le tecniche narrative de "Il ponte della Ghisolfa" di Giovanni Testori

    No full text
    L’articolo propone una lettura critica della raccolta di racconti Il ponte della Ghisolfa (1958) di Giovanni Testori che mira a dimostrare come il realismo della narrazione sia solo apparente. Attraverso una disamina delle tecniche narrative messe in campo dallo scrittore milanese, vengono evidenziati i significativi addentellati di quest’opera con la grande tradizione del romanzo modernista (non solo italiano) e con le avanguardie storiche (in particolare il Surrealismo). Dall’analisi si delinea il quadro di un’opera sotto diversi aspetti sperimentale e innovativa (soprattutto rispetto al Neorealismo, a quel tempo ormai in crisi), nonché capace di contribuire in maniera significativa al rinnovamento del panorama letterario italiano della seconda parte del Novecento

    Life cycle assessment of a DC-LINK capacitor used for automotive applications

    No full text
    In the automotive sector, which is increasingly focused on reducing its environmental impact, limited attention has been given to power systems and components involved in vehicle electrification. This study aims to propose a cradle-to-gate Life Cycle Assessment (LCA) applied to a DC-LINK capacitor (dimensions 130 mm∗48 mm∗247 mm and expected reference service life - RSL of 8000 h of driving), manufactured by a leading company in the sector. The aim of the research is filling existing gaps concerning the material composition of DC-LINKs and relative environmental impacts. The analysis examines the contributions of the various materials within the product and develops sensitivity scenarios to evaluate the influence of electricity used during manufacturing and the benefits associated with using secondary materials instead of virgin ones. The Climate Change impacts estimated for the Baseline scenario resulted in 9.50 kg CO2 eq per DC-LINK produced, with material components contributing 88.2 %. The complete hotspot analysis highlighted a general significant influence of the material components, which accounted for at least 57.8 % across all 18 environmental categories examined. The minimal contribution of electricity is justified by the company's decision to use a fully renewable energy mix. The use of secondary copper and aluminium proved advantageous, as it can reduce the climate change impacts of the finished product by 10–14 % with respect to the Baseline. In conclusion, the findings underscore the importance of considering the entire life cycle when assessing the sustainability of components used in the automotive sector and identifying the best strategies for reducing their impacts
